リードフルスタックエンジニア

求人ID : 10176
投稿日 : 2026-03-26
業界 : IT・情報サービス
雇用形態 : 正社員, 常勤
必須スキル : Full Stack Development, Microservices Architecture, ReactJS TypeScript, Java Spring Boot, Azure Cloud DevOps, CI CD Pipelines, AI LLM Integration
市区町村 : 東京(ハイブリッド)
都道府県: 東京(ハイブリッド)
国 : 日本
年俸 : 8,000,000 ~ 10,000,000

仕事内容

魅力的なポイント:

  • 最先端のクラウドネイティブエンジニアリングプロジェクトを主導し、アーキテクチャ、開発、デプロイメントのエンドツーエンドの責任を担います。

  • AI/LLM、Azureクラウドサービス、スケーラブルなマイクロサービスなどの最新技術を活用し、インパクトのあるエンタープライズソリューションを構築します。

  • ハイパフォーマンスなエンジニアリングチームを指導・育成し、イノベーション、ベストプラクティス、そして卓越した技術を推進します。

年収: 800万円以上

職務内容:

  • 当社では、当社の標準エンジニアリングスタックに準拠した最新のクラウドネイティブアプリケーションの構築と運用において、実践的な技術的リーダーシップを発揮できるリードフルスタックエンジニア(テクニカルリード)を募集しています。このポジションでは、バックエンドとフロントエンド全体にわたるエンドツーエンドのエンジニアリング実行を推進し、アーキテクチャ、セキュリティ、CI/CD、信頼性について強い責任感を持って取り組みます。製品チームや他部門のステークホルダーと緊密に連携し、エンジニアの指導を行い、AIと大規模言語モデル(LLM)機能を統合したスケーラブルなソリューションを提供するための技術的な意思決定を主導します。

職務内容:

  • ソフトウェア開発ライフサイクル全体(設計、構築、テスト、デプロイ、運用)において、技術的なリーダーシップを発揮します。

  • システムおよびアプリケーションアーキテクチャに関する議論を主導し、技術設計図や図面を作成・維持します。
  • フロントエンドにはReactJSとTypeScript、バックエンドにはJava 17 + Spring Boot 3を用いて、フルスタックアプリケーションを構築・維持します。
  • 明確な関心の分離、スケーラビリティ、保守性を考慮したマイクロサービスとREST APIの設計・実装を行います。
  • キャッシング戦略やデータモデリングを含むデータレイヤー(SQL/NoSQL)の設計・最適化を行います。
  • エンタープライズID(例:Microsoft Entra ID)とトークンベースのパターン(OAuth2/JWT)を用いて、安全な認証と認可を実装します。
  • アプリケーションおよびネットワークセキュリティのベストプラクティス(HTTPS、CORS、CSRF対策、レート制限、プライベートエンドポイント、ファイアウォールルール)を適用します。
  • Azure DevOps(パイプライン、リリース)を用いたCI/CDプラクティスを管理し、必要なコード品質とセキュリティスキャンが統合されていることを確認します。
  • Dockerを使用してコンテナ化されたワークロードを構築およびデプロイし、Azure App ServiceやAzure Kubernetes Service(AKS)などの承認済みAzureホスティングプラットフォーム上でサービスを実行します。
  • Azure Key Vault(シークレット)、Azure Blob Storage、Azure SQL Database、Cosmos DBなどのAzureネイティブサービスを使用します。
  • コードレビュー、自動テスト戦略、可観測性/モニタリング、パフォーマンスチューニング、ドキュメント作成といったエンジニアリングのベストプラクティスを推進します。
  • エンジニアのメンターおよびコーチを務め、再利用可能なパターン、標準、リファレンス実装を確立します。
  • 機能計画、優先順位付け、および技術リスク管理に関して、クロスファンクショナルチームと連携します。
  • 製品固有のユースケースをサポートするために、AI/LLMモデル(LoRa/PEFTなど)のトレーニング、微調整、またはパラメータ効率的な適応を行います。

応募資格:

  • フルスタック開発における7年以上の実務経験(技術リーダーシップ経験を含む)。

  • JavaおよびSpring Boot(Spring Boot 3が望ましい)を用いた強力なバックエンド開発およびアーキテクチャスキル。
  • .NETを用いたバックエンドサービスの構築経験があれば尚可(統合および近代化シナリオ向け)。
  • ReactJSおよびTypeScriptの熟練度。UI/UXの原則とレスポンシブデザインに関する理解。
  • マイクロサービスアーキテクチャ、RESTful API、イベント駆動型または非同期処理パターンに関する経験。
  • システム設計の基礎知識(データ構造、分散システム、パフォーマンス)。
  • リレーショナルデータベースおよび1つ以上のNoSQLデータベースに関する経験。キャッシングに関する経験があれば尚可。
  • エンタープライズアプリケーションで一般的に使用されるAzureサービス(App Serviceおよび/またはAKS、Entra ID、Key Vault、Blob Storage、Azure SQL、Cosmos DBなど)の実務経験。
  • Azure DevOpsを用いたCI/CDの経験。Gitを使用したリポジトリ管理の実践経験。
  • ネットワークの基礎知識(DNS、ロードバランシング、ファイアウォール、VPN)に関する深い理解。
  • 明確なコミュニケーション能力と、チームやステークホルダーとの協業実績。

優遇される資格:

  • Azure Monitor / Application Insightsおよびログ分析による可観測性。
  • 承認済みのTerraformテンプレート/モジュールを使用したInfrastructure as Code。
  • OpenAPI/Swaggerを使用したAPI仕様およびドキュメント作成。
  • 最新の機械学習フレームワーク(PyTorch、TensorFlowなど)を使用した大規模言語モデルまたは機械学習モデルの微調整またはカスタマイズの経験。

歓迎するスキル:

  • 日本語能力。
  • アジャイルチームおよび異文化環境での業務経験。
  • エンタープライズ依存関係管理およびアーティファクトリポジトリ(例:JFrog/Artifactory)の使用経験。

語学要件:

  • 日本語:ビジネスレベル以上
  • 英語:ビジネスレベル

企業概要

  • クライアント企業は40カ国以上で事業を展開し、米国、日本、ラテンアメリカ、アジア、ヨーロッパ、中東で市場をリードする地位を確立しています。2018年のフォーチュン500リストでは43位にランクインしています。150年以上の歴史を持つ当社は、代理店、銀行やブローカーなどの第三者販売業者、およびダイレクトマーケティングチャネルを通じて、生命保険、傷害保険、健康保険、退職金、貯蓄商品を提供しています。世界中で約1億人のお客様に認知され、信頼されており、米国のフォーチュン500企業上位100社のうち90社以上を顧客としています。


AI求人マッチング

レジュメをアップロードするだけ!
AIがあなたの経歴に合った求人を ご提案いたします。